'Mindscapes' opens with reception at Civic Arts League

The Civic Arts League of Chattanooga will host a reception on Friday, Feb. 2, from 5 to 7 p.m. to open its new exhibit, "Mindscapes."

The reception and exhibit are in Exum Gallery, inside St. Paul's Episcopal Church, 305 W. Seventh St.

The theme of this exhibit is "to see the world with an artist's eye is to create mindscapes" - images in the mind of an artist that transform the ordinary and the extraordinary around us into personal expressions on canvas, paper and other mediums.

Pieces will range in style from realism and Impressionism to the whimsical and abstract.

The exhibit will continue through Feb. 28. Gallery hours are 8:30 a.m.-4:30 p.m. Monday-Friday and Sundays during regular worship hours.

The Civic Arts League Inc. is a nonprofit consisting of artists dedicated to the stimulation of the creative arts and the promotion of its cultural and educational interests in our area. Members meet the first Monday of every month (except in July and some holidays) at 6 p.m. in Grace Episcopal Church, 20 Belvoir Ave.
